I had been lax in updating Chrome in my Windows 8 installation, but the only problem I really have with the "Metro" version of Chrome is it looks exactly like the desktop version. What I am mainly referring to is that it has the min,max,close buttons. I often use alt+tab to switch windows so don't use them often, but accidentally hit the minimize and it just went down to the lower left corner and I could see part of it there.

I think Chrome needs to "Metro-ize" the browser rather than just stick the desktop version inside the Metro shell or however they did it.

Still nice to use something different than IE.

Sony's BAR models are currently at their lowest prices which makes them solid offerings. The company's BRAVIA Theatre Bar lineup is designed to suit different home cinema needs. The Bar 5 is an entry-level 3.1-channel soundbar with a wireless subwoofer, supporting Dolby Atmos®, DTS:X, S-Force PRO Front Surround, and Vertical Surround Engine for immersive audio with clear dialogue. The Bar 6 upgrades to a 3.1.2-channel configuration by adding dedicated up-firing speakers for more convincing overhead Atmos effects while retaining the wireless subwoofer. At the premium end, the Bar 7, Bar 8, and flagship Bar 9 are single-soundbar solutions featuring Sony’s 360 Spatial Sound Mapping technology, which creates phantom speakers for a wider surround field. Bar 7 includes nine speaker units, Bar 8 increases this to eleven, and Bar 9 offers thirteen speaker driver units promising the most expansive soundstage and acoustic performance. All models should integrate seamlessly with compatible BRAVIA TVs and support the BRAVIA Connect app for setup and control.
